Ts7.1 Beta 8 Animation
Has anyone done any physical simulation using the animation features of Ts7? I've been trying to create some gears and test out gear ratios. Want to make one gear turn and the other react to it, but can't figure out how to get it going. Any help would be nice.

Re: Ts7.1 Beta 8 Animation
Well create two fixed pivot points on both your objects, assign a physics material to both, then assign a constant rotational force to one of the cogs. Watch them spin when you hit "Run Simulation"! button. Then you can even tug around, stop the simulation, etc, in realtime. Later you can bake the animation if you'd like. You could also animate the rotation of one, and assign the two pins to the other obejct and watch it also spin. make sure your colission fidelity is very high.

Re: Ts7.1 Beta 8 Animation
TS 7.6 model side
The blue gear has no physics properties and is keyframe animated to spin. It is the motor to drive the rest. The green and pink gears are driven by physics simulation. They move because the blue gear is turning.
The green and pink gears have physics properties and each has an Object Fixation Point at the centers of the end faces.
To add Object Fixation Points first give the object basic physics properties (cloth, wood, metal). Then select it and click the Fixation Point 1 icon. The point will appear in the center of the object. Move the fixation point, as you would move any object, to the desired location. In this case to the center of one 'round' face. Create fixation point 2 for the other face. There is an option somewhere for the fixation points to move with the object. I don't know where that is but be sure they do.
For best results with TS physics right click the start simulation icon. Constant time: uncheck, collision detection: vertex + face, integrity checking: all.
Attached is a zip with the TS 7.6 model side scene file for this.
For attaching things (group ?) to gears I can only guess. Things to try:
- In any case do grouping, Booleans, etc. first then apply physics or keyframes.
- Try applying the physics properties to a group rather than its components.
- Use a rigid IK joint to connect the objects. No skeleton is needed for this. You can connect objects directly with IK joints in TS.
- Use the Mesh Collapse plug-in to merge the objects into one mesh.

Edit: I tried this with 10 or 11 gears. The fixation points will move with a gear and will move with multiple gears selected but won't rotate with them even if they are grouped. The fixation points are hard to keep in the correct positions. The errors where things move into each other accumulate so that the gear teeth co-occupy space and gears don't rotate correctly. You would have to use many polygons on the objects to improve that and the simulation would be very slow.
lrdsatyr8, I would not recommend TS for physics simulations of your gears unless it is just two or three. If you just want to key frame animated gears for illustration maybe but not as a test of function. Maybe Blender is what you need for that. I don't know Blender yet but its physics seems much better based on videos of things people have done.

Thanks Finis... you helped alot. I did find that you have to actually phsychically make the entire housing that the pivots sit in for it to work. For example... if you have a gear, you have to have it on a axle... and the axle must be sitting in a hole at both ends on a fixed object that doesn't move. That helped alot. The physics work, but you're right... they are slow. Took about an hour to get a good gear train to move properly but it worked enough to prove a hypothesis I had about a gearing system for a particular project I'm working on.
